Phase I Metabolism of Novel Phencyclidine Derivative 3‐Cl‐PCP: In Vitro Studies With Pooled Human Liver Microsomes and Investigation of a Post‐Mortem Case

open access: yesDrug Testing and Analysis, EarlyView.
A fatal 3‐chloro‐phencyclidine (3‐Cl‐PCP) intoxication was investigated by analyzing postmortem samples and a pooled human liver microsomes assay. Tentative metabolite identification was performed by liquid chromatography‐quadrupole time‐of‐flight mass spectrometry (LC‐QTOF‐MS). Seven phase I metabolites were identified.

In Vitro Characterization of Technological and Health‐Promoting Properties of Enterocin Producing Lactic Acid Bacteria From Camel Milk and Its Suitability as a Dairy Starter

open access: yesFood Chemistry International, EarlyView.
Enterocin‐producing Enterococcus faecium RSCUDR7 from camel milk exhibited strong probiotic and antimicrobial properties, along with stability in skim milk. Its suitability as a safe and effective dairy starter highlights its potential for developing functional probiotic dairy products.
